Output c476595aee31848b23f062ece6961baab8b66eb34420901552df38dbe41d9ed3:1
- value
- 22825460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c25807f6c7b114f9a4821a55cf112c2f6ffab1c1 OP_EQUAL
- address
- 3KQcUGUKpng7TSXZ4RKuVWQFvPibKuKmhH
- transaction
- c476595aee31848b23f062ece6961baab8b66eb34420901552df38dbe41d9ed3
- confirmations
- 105572
- spent
- true